news 2026/3/27 3:39:45

AI智能视频生成器:零基础快速创作专业视频的终极指南

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
AI智能视频生成器:零基础快速创作专业视频的终极指南

AI智能视频生成器:零基础快速创作专业视频的终极指南

【免费下载链接】AI-Auto-Video-GeneratorAn AI-powered storytelling video generator that takes user input as a story prompt, generates a story using OpenAI's GPT-3, creates images using OpenAI's DALL-E, adds voiceover using ElevenLabs API, and combines the elements into a video.项目地址: https://gitcode.com/gh_mirrors/ai/AI-Auto-Video-Generator

在人工智能技术飞速发展的今天,AI-Auto-Video-Generator项目为内容创作者提供了一个革命性的解决方案——将简单的文字描述自动转换为完整的视频作品。这个开源工具集成了OpenAI GPT-3、DALL-E和ElevenLabs等顶尖AI技术,让任何人都能在几分钟内创作出专业水准的视频内容。

🎯 项目核心价值

一键式智能创作流程

AI-Auto-Video-Generator采用模块化设计,将复杂的视频制作过程简化为四个智能步骤:

智能故事创作(story_generator.py) 基于用户输入的关键词或主题,系统自动生成逻辑连贯、情节丰富的故事内容。GPT-3大语言模型确保故事的专业性和趣味性。

视觉图像生成(image_generator.py) DALL-E图像生成技术将文字描述转化为高清视觉画面,每个场景都精准匹配故事情节。

专业语音合成(voiceover_generator.py) ElevenLabs API提供自然流畅的语音旁白,支持多种语言和音色选择。

自动视频合成(video_creator.py) MoviePy库将图像、语音和字幕完美整合,生成最终视频文件。

🚀 五分钟快速上手教程

环境准备与项目部署

  1. 系统要求检查

    • Python 3.6或更高版本
    • FFmpeg视频处理工具
    • 稳定的网络连接
  2. 项目获取与配置

git clone https://gitcode.com/gh_mirrors/ai/AI-Auto-Video-Generator cd AI-Auto-Video-Generator
  1. 依赖包安装
pip install -r requirements.txt python -m spacy download en_core_web_sm
  1. API密钥配置在项目根目录创建.env文件,添加以下内容:
OPENAI_API_KEY=您的OpenAI密钥 ELEVENLABS_API_KEY=您的ElevenLabs密钥

首次视频创作体验

运行主程序开始你的创作之旅:

python main.py

系统将引导你完成:

  • 输入故事主题或关键词
  • 确认生成的故事情节
  • 自动创建视觉图像
  • 生成语音旁白
  • 合成最终视频文件

💡 实用功能详解

字幕生成系统

caption_generator.py模块提供智能字幕功能:

  • 自动将故事文本分割为合适的字幕片段
  • 支持自定义字体和样式
  • 可调节字幕显示时长

关键词识别技术

keyword_identifier.py自动分析故事内容,提取关键场景描述,为图像生成提供精准的视觉指导。

🎨 多样化应用场景

教育领域应用

  • 知识点可视化:将抽象概念转化为生动图像
  • 历史故事再现:让历史事件活灵活现
  • 科学原理演示:复杂原理的直观展示

商业推广价值

  • 产品展示视频:低成本制作产品介绍
  • 品牌故事传播:增强品牌情感连接
  • 营销内容创作:快速产出社交媒体素材

创意内容制作

  • 诗歌动画演绎:文字艺术的视觉呈现
  • 童话故事改编:经典故事的现代化表达
  • 个性化祝福视频:特殊场合的创意表达

🔧 高级定制功能

参数调节选项

用户可根据需求调整多个创作参数:

故事长度控制通过修改max_tokens参数控制生成故事的详细程度。

图像数量设置调整num_prompts参数决定视频包含的场景数量。

语音风格选择支持多种语音类型和语速调节。

批量处理能力

通过脚本修改可实现批量视频生成,适用于:

  • 系列课程制作
  • 产品线介绍
  • 节日祝福批量发送

📊 技术优势分析

集成创新设计

  • 多AI技术融合:GPT-3、DALL-E、ElevenLabs无缝协作
  • 模块化架构:便于功能扩展和维护
  • 完整错误处理:确保创作流程的稳定性

用户体验优化

  • 命令行交互:操作简单直观
  • 自动保存机制:防止意外中断导致数据丢失
  • 进度可视化:实时显示创作进度

🛠️ 常见问题解决方案

依赖包安装问题

确保使用虚拟环境并正确安装requirements.txt中列出的所有包。

API配置注意事项

  • 密钥需从官方平台获取
  • 注意API使用配额限制
  • 建议测试阶段使用较低参数

视频质量优化技巧

  • 提供详细的情景描述以获得更精准的图像
  • 长篇内容建议分段处理
  • 合理设置图像分辨率参数

🌟 项目发展前景

AI-Auto-Video-Generator代表了AI技术在创意内容制作领域的重要突破。随着技术的不断进步,未来版本将支持:

  • 更多语言和方言
  • 更丰富的视觉风格
  • 实时预览功能
  • 云端协作支持

结语

无论你是教育工作者、内容创作者、营销人员还是技术爱好者,AI-Auto-Video-Generator都能为你提供一个简单高效的视频创作解决方案。通过智能化的创作流程,你将能够专注于内容创意,而将技术实现交给AI完成。

立即开始你的AI视频创作之旅,将想法快速转化为精彩的视觉内容!

【免费下载链接】AI-Auto-Video-GeneratorAn AI-powered storytelling video generator that takes user input as a story prompt, generates a story using OpenAI's GPT-3, creates images using OpenAI's DALL-E, adds voiceover using ElevenLabs API, and combines the elements into a video.项目地址: https://gitcode.com/gh_mirrors/ai/AI-Auto-Video-Generator

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/3/18 1:11:53

Keil4安装教程:STM32下载器配置核心要点

Keil4 STM32开发环境搭建:从零配置下载器到一键烧录的实战指南 你有没有遇到过这样的场景? 新装的Keil4打开工程,点击“Download”却弹出 “No Algorithm Found” ; 或者连接ST-Link后提示 “Cannot connect to target” …

作者头像 李华
网站建设 2026/3/26 21:54:00

Arduino-ESP32 3.2.0版本深度解析:基于ESP-IDF 5.4的物联网开发新纪元

Arduino-ESP32 3.2.0版本深度解析:基于ESP-IDF 5.4的物联网开发新纪元 【免费下载链接】arduino-esp32 Arduino core for the ESP32 项目地址: https://gitcode.com/GitHub_Trending/ar/arduino-esp32 版本亮点速览 Arduino-ESP32项目迎来了具有里程碑意义的…

作者头像 李华
网站建设 2026/3/26 22:30:50

5分钟掌握UE4SS:Unreal Engine游戏脚本开发的终极利器

5分钟掌握UE4SS:Unreal Engine游戏脚本开发的终极利器 【免费下载链接】RE-UE4SS Injectable LUA scripting system, SDK generator, live property editor and other dumping utilities for UE4/5 games 项目地址: https://gitcode.com/gh_mirrors/re/RE-UE4SS …

作者头像 李华
网站建设 2026/3/27 1:03:14

ARM64数据处理指令入门:完整示例演示操作

与硬件对话:ARM64数据处理指令实战入门你有没有想过,当你的代码在苹果M1芯片上飞速运行时,底层究竟发生了什么?不是虚拟机、不是解释器——而是一条条精炼的汇编指令,直接操控着寄存器和运算单元。而这一切的核心&…

作者头像 李华
网站建设 2026/3/23 6:18:55

Flutter Admin后台管理系统:从零开始构建专业级管理平台

Flutter Admin后台管理系统:从零开始构建专业级管理平台 【免费下载链接】flutter_admin Flutter Admin: 一个基于 Flutter 的后台管理系统、开发模板。A backend management system and development template based on Flutter 项目地址: https://gitcode.com/gh…

作者头像 李华
网站建设 2026/3/20 5:57:20

Zotero阅读列表终极指南:免费高效的文献进度管理神器

Zotero阅读列表终极指南:免费高效的文献进度管理神器 【免费下载链接】zotero-reading-list Keep track of whether youve read items in Zotero 项目地址: https://gitcode.com/gh_mirrors/zo/zotero-reading-list 还在为学术文献堆积如山而焦虑&#xff1f…

作者头像 李华